Building Integrated Photovoltaic Skylights Market
Overview
The Building Integrated Photovoltaic Skylights Market focuses on energy-generating skylight solutions that seamlessly integrate photovoltaic (PV) technology into building structures. These skylights not only provide natural daylighting but also harness solar energy to produce clean electricity, making them a dual-purpose component in sustainable architecture.
Building Integrated Photovoltaic (BIPV) skylights contribute to reduced energy consumption, lower carbon emissions, and enhanced indoor comfort, positioning them as a vital element in green building design. The Building Integrated Photovoltaic Skylights Market supports efforts to meet global sustainability targets and improve energy efficiency in commercial, residential, and institutional buildings.
As demand for eco-friendly construction solutions grows, the Building Integrated Photovoltaic Skylights Market is gaining traction among architects, developers, and facility managers aiming to combine aesthetics with renewable energy generation.

The Building Integrated Photovoltaic Skylights Market is estimated to be valued at around USD 1.3 billion in the current year. Driven by increasing adoption of renewable energy systems and green building initiatives, the market is projected to reach approximately USD 4.1 billion by 2032.
This growth translates to a compound annual growth rate (CAGR) of about 12.9% over the forecast period. Rising construction of energy-efficient infrastructure, supportive government policies for solar integration, and growing awareness of lifecycle cost savings are key factors fueling market expansion.
Integrating energy generation with daylighting solutions continues to push demand for innovative BIPV skylight products in both new builds and retrofits.
Key Drivers
Increasing focus on net-zero energy buildings and sustainable design
Government incentives and regulations promoting solar integration
Growing demand for energy cost savings and reduced utility bills
Rising adoption of green building certifications (e.g., LEED, BREEAM)
Enhanced architectural aesthetics with functional energy-generating components
Restraints
Higher upfront installation and material costs compared to conventional skylights
Technical complexities in integrating PV systems with structural elements
Limited awareness among small-scale developers and homeowners
Variations in solar irradiance impacting energy generation potential

Regional Insights
North America
North America holds a significant share in the Building Integrated Photovoltaic Skylights Market, driven by strong sustainability mandates in building codes and incentives for solar integration. Commercial and institutional projects increasingly adopt BIPV skylights to achieve energy performance targets.
Europe
Europe is a key region for the Building Integrated Photovoltaic Skylights Market, supported by aggressive renewable energy policies, stringent energy efficiency standards, and widespread green building initiatives. Urban developments and retrofit projects are expanding PV skylight adoption.
Asia-Pacific
Asia-Pacific is the fastest-growing region in the Building Integrated Photovoltaic Skylights Market, propelled by rapid urbanization, rising construction activities, and growing investment in renewable energy infrastructure. Countries like China, Japan, South Korea, and India are boosting solar integration in buildings.
Latin America
In Latin America, the Building Integrated Photovoltaic Skylights Market is expanding gradually as governments promote sustainable construction practices. Solar-rich environments and increasing commercial development support steady growth in BIPV skylight installations.
Middle East & Africa
The Middle East & Africa region is witnessing rising interest in the Building Integrated Photovoltaic Skylights Market, driven by abundant solar resources and growing investments in eco-friendly infrastructure. Large-scale commercial projects and luxury developments are exploring PV-integrated skylights.
